Blue-crowned laughing thrush

Dryonastes courtoisi, free-flying in Tropical Realm, Chester. 21st February 2009.
Are they not a garrulax?
 
For me they're Garrulax courtousi. But you know, taxonomist changes constantly all animal names...
 
I'm not a taxonomist. I decided quite a while ago to use the same names as ISIS; they can't be too badly wrong and it makes it easier to keep track of the subjects.

Alan
 
In the 1980s H.Wolters investigated the large genus Garrulax and as a splitter he elevated many subgenera to generic rank. Most of his work has been vindicated by modern DNA analysis. So at the moment this species is a member of Dryonastes.

I use the names given in Handbook of the Birds of the World, seems like ISIS also does now.
